National Association of Wheat Growers et al v. Zeise et al
Filing
38
ORDER signed by Senior Judge William B. Shubb on 1/3/2018 GRANTING #34 State of Missouri, State of Idaho, State of Indiana, State of Iowa, State of Louisiana, State of Kansas, State of Michigan, State of North Dakota, State of Oklahoma, State of South Dakota and State of Wisconsin's Motion to file Amicus Brief. The brief shall be filed within two days of entry of this Order. Defendants may respond to any arguments presented in the amicus brief in their opposition to the Motion for Preliminary Injunction but are not required to do so. (Kirksey Smith, K)
